Most significant achievements (in last five years)

· Registered more than 27,000 farmers of Nagaland for mobile-based SMS services under the GKMS project funded by Indian Meteorological Department, Ministry of Earth Sciences, GoI. A total of 30,389 farmers benefitted from the Agromet advisory services.
